Expectations:
- Node.js + TypeScript - ability to independently type code that lacks typing, understand the difference between a type and an interface, and proficiently use asynchronous programming (async/await/promise).
- REST, Message Broker, Microservices - understanding how services communicate and the methods for synchronous or asynchronous communication between services.
- Design Patterns - ability to identify and apply basic design patterns.
- Software Testing - familiarity with at least one code testing tool, understanding why writing tests is an important stage in software development.
- Containerization - ability to independently prepare a container containing an application / ability to set up a local environment for a service using Docker Compose.
- Troubleshooting - ability to independently propose a solution to a given problem and assess its strengths and weaknesses.

What project will you be working on?
We are currently seeking a specialist to contribute to the development of the transport and logistics platform, Trans.eu. Our platform offers a range of business services, such as cost forecasting for transporting specific cargo and facilitating transactions between parties. Additionally, it includes technical services managing configuration and monitoring RabbitMQ. Communication within the team is conducted in Polish; however, a basic understanding of English for reading documentation is required.
Our team operates under the NASA umbrella, specializing in creating interactive maps and geocoding from scratch for the trans.eu platform. We are in search of a Developer who can assist us in enhancing these features and oversee the route planning system. The goal is to provide innovative logistic solutions on an international scale.
